  With so much competition for every job listing out there there are more than 6.1 job seekers for every job opening, according to the latest job-opening and turnover data from the U.S. Department of Labor wowing a recruiter during a job interview is even more crucial. According to a new survey of nearly 500 human-resources professionals released by the Society for Human Resource Management, there are plenty of ways to derail a job interview and some of them may surprise you.
  現在的就業市場競爭十分激烈─根據美國勞工部(U.S. Department of Labor)最新的公司招聘及人才流動數據,每一個招聘職位對應超過6.1名應聘者;因此,在面試時給招聘方留下深刻印象顯得尤爲重要。美國人力資源協會 (U.S. Department of Labor)最近對近500名人力資源經理做了一項新調查,發現應聘者在面試過程中有很多地方容易把事情搞砸,其中一些可能會讓你大吃一驚。
  The basic don’ts: arriving late to an interview or trashing a previous employer. But some hiring managers say even experienced professionals have made other slip-ups.
  有幾個基本的錯誤不要犯:一是參加面試時遲到,二是貶低以前的僱主。不過,一些招聘經理說,有時候甚至連久經沙場的應聘者也會陰溝裏翻船。
  Often, job candidates speak in a too-familiar way with hiring managers a major problem, according to 20% of survey respondents. Mary Willoughby, director of human resources at the Center for Disability Rights in Rochester, N.Y., once interviewed someone who was so comfortable, he commented on a sty she had near her eye.
  應聘者往往會以一種過於親暱的語氣與招聘經理交談──根據20%受訪者的反饋,這是一個普遍問題。紐約州羅切斯特市殘疾人維權中心(Center for Disability Rights)的人力資源主管瑪麗•維羅比(Mary Willoughby)說,有一次她面試的應聘者自我感覺過於良好,居然評論起她眼角的一個麥粒腫。
  ’My mind was made up at that point,’ she says. The candidate was not hired.
  “當時我就做出了決定,” 瑪麗說。那名應聘者沒有得到職位。
  For 67% of hiring managers who responded to the survey, dressing provocatively is a major deal breaker even more significant than having a typo in your application materials (58% found this to be an interview killer). Chantal Verbeek, head of enterprise talent at ING U.S. Financial Services, says she’ll forgive a typo if the applicant’s skills are extraordinary, but revealing or sloppy apparel equals an instant rejection. ’You’d think that’d be obvious,’ she says.
  67% 的受訪者認爲,着裝不當是個大忌──比求職簡歷中出現錯字都要嚴重(58%的.接受調查者認爲這是一個重大失誤)。荷蘭國際集團美國金融服務業務部(ING U.S. Financial Services)人力資源部的負責人查恩塔爾•沃比克(Chantal Verbeek)說,如果應聘者技能出衆,她可以原諒簡歷中出現一個錯字,但衣着暴露或穿着懶散等同於立刻被拒絕。“這一點很明顯。”她說道。
